Easy Red Pepper Jam

This jam is the perfect balance of sweet and spicy with a little kick to keep things interesting! Spread it on toast, drizzle over cheese, or slather it on ribs and burgers for a flavor boost. The possibilities are endless with this zesty jam!

Ingredients

  • 3 Large Red Bell Peppers, deseeded and chopped
  • ⅓ cup Pineapple Juice
  • ⅓ cup Sugar
  • ⅓ cup Pineapple Habanero White Barrel Aged Balsamic
  • ½ tsp Chili Verde Flake Sea Salt

Directions

  1. In a food processor or high-speed blender, pulse bell peppers and pineapple juice until finely chopped.
  2. In a medium saucepan over high heat, add the bell pepper mixture, sugar, and Pineapple Habanero White Barrel Aged Balsamic. Bring to a boil then turn down heat to medium, stirring occasionally for 20-30 minutes, until jam has thickened to desired consistency.
  3. Finish with Chili Verde Flake Sea Salt. Once cooled completely, store in an airtight container in the refrigerator. Or try with our Fried Egg, Prosciutto, and Red Pepper Jam Breakfast Sandwich!
